Long term oxygen therapy (LTOT or home oxygen) can be given via a: 1. tube positioned under the nose (nasal cannula) 2. face mask placed over the nose and mouth 3. mask attached to an opening in the throat (tracheostomy) Oxygen must only be prescribed by a specialist after a clinical review. This … See more Do not turn up a person’s home oxygen supply without discussion with a specialist. You should also advise the person not to do this. Contact a clinician for advice. WebFor people starting home oxygen electively, a review at home should be undertaken in four weeks to enable re-assessment of the person’s clinical status, adherence to the oxygen therapy regime (including the appropriateness of the equipment), safety review to reduce risks including fire and falls and whether further action is necessary (e.g. referral back to … WebBackground.
